As the second half of the thoroughbred season gallops into focus, a review shows Todd Pletcher's filly, Rags to Riches, and Derby champ Street Sense still in charge.
Steve Asmussen's Curlin, without juvenile racing experience, crept into a top spot throughout the first half of 2007 to make his name in the three-year-old classics. Carl Nafzger's Street Sense won the most famous race in the world, the Kentucky Derby, and Todd Pletcher finally cracked the classic winner's circle with a filly, a very fit female named Rags to Riches.
Early Kentucky Derby and possible Triple Crown contenders Buffalo Man, E Z Warrior, Hard Spun, Notional and Bwana Bull all showed up to win in January.

(Note: Times recorded reflect the changeover some parks have made to clocking in hundreds of a second, replacing the standard fifths of a second, in measuring a thoroughbred's distance speed.)
In February, Nobiz Like Shobiz joined the Derby contender parade with a win, as did Ravel and Any Given Saturday. Notional captured his second win. Liquidity, Cowtown Cat, and Imawildandcrazyguy placed. Scat Daddy showed. All were considered strong Derby chasers.
